Lowered Greenhouse Gas Emissions
Heat pumps run on power and essentially transfer warm from the air, even when it's chilly exterior. They are able to draw out the complimentary warm trapped in air bits and relocate them inside, reducing moisture while doing so.

Compared to gas heaters, modern-day heat pumps make use of less than one kilowatt of electrical power per kilowatt of home heating power they create. This makes them the most power efficient heating option available with a POLICE OFFICER (Coefficient of Performance) of 4 or even more. By lowering the requirement for fossil fuels, heatpump help in reducing greenhouse gas emissions and reduce other major air contaminants.

Flexibility
Heatpump can be utilized in numerous types of homes and buildings-- with or without ducts. They work with hot-water radiators, air-conditioning and programmable thermostats. They can replace heaters or be set up in new homes. They can run on photovoltaic panels, geothermal systems or even district heating sources like wastewater.

They're excellent at delivering more heat per power unit. For example, an air-source heatpump creates up to 3 or more heating devices from each electrical energy unit it consumes.



Getting one of the most from your heat pump will depend on your environment zone and quality of insulation. Look for versions with ENERGY STAR ratings and contrast their SEER or HSPF specifications. In warmer environments, focus on SEER; in colder regions, consider a system with a greater HSPF ranking. Furthermore, invest in air sealing and insulation to minimize the lots on your heatpump. Biomass Boilers
Biomass boilers utilize wood pellets, chips or logs to produce warmth and hot water. They are a great choice for off-grid homes or those that intend to get off the gas grid.

As a standalone heating unit, biomass can offer enough power to maintain your home warm throughout the year without the regular heat drop off of various other renewable innovations. They can likewise be made use of in conjunction with photovoltaic panels to increase financial savings and gain from RHI repayments.

A drawback of these systems is the ahead of time expense and normal fuel shipments.
